the fernhurst society
The charity supports children and young people and the general public. The Fernhurst Society is a registered charity whose purpose is education and training. It delivers its work by providing human resources. The charity is based in Haslemere and operates in West Sussex.

Activities & Mission
The Fernhurst Archives handles numerous enquiries,many requiring extensive research by the archivists; has published notelets; held exhibitions; oral history recordings; Researching non-listed but 'interesting'houses; recording and listing graves; collecting 'Facts on Fernhurst' for publication. Our programme of walks and talks continue to create interest for our membership.
